The Fundamental Difference: Wheat Varieties

At the core of the European vs. American flour debate are the different wheat varieties cultivated and favored in each region. The United States primarily grows hard red wheat, known for its high protein and high gluten content. This type of wheat is favored for its strong gluten structure, which is ideal for producing resilient dough for mass-produced breads. In contrast, European countries predominantly use soft white wheat and ancient grains like spelt, which contain lower protein and less gluten. For individuals with a non-celiac gluten sensitivity, consuming lower-gluten products can significantly reduce symptoms like bloating and inflammation.

The Role of Environmental Factors

Beyond the specific wheat variety, environmental conditions play a part in gluten levels. Research suggests that wheat grown in hotter, drier conditions—more common in many U.S. growing regions—can have higher gluten content. Conversely, Europe's generally milder climate can lead to wheat with lower gluten. Differences in soil composition, such as higher sulfur content in some European soils, have also been posited as a factor that may influence the gliadin protein component of gluten, potentially making it less reactive for some individuals.

Regulation and Additives

One of the most significant arguments for why is European flour better for you lies in the stark contrast in agricultural and processing regulations. The European Union has a far stricter stance on chemical use, banning many substances that are still common in U.S. food production. This includes:

  • Glyphosate: The EU has banned or heavily restricted the use of this herbicide on crops, a practice known as desiccation, which is widespread in the U.S. The presence of glyphosate residues has been linked to disruptions in the gut microbiome.
  • Potassium Bromate: This dough conditioner, a potential carcinogen, is banned in the EU but allowed in the U.S..
  • Bleaching Agents: Chlorine gas and other bleaching agents, which alter the flour's natural color and flavor, are prohibited in the EU. European mills rely on natural aging, while these chemicals are used to speed up processing in the U.S..
  • Fortification: The U.S. mandates fortification of non-organic refined flour with synthetic vitamins and iron. Some experts suggest the form of iron used may not be easily absorbed and could promote undesirable bacteria growth in the gut. European countries do not mandate this fortification, preserving the flour's natural composition.

The Power of Traditional Processing

The method of preparing and baking flour-based goods also plays a critical role in digestibility. Traditional European baking, especially with artisanal breads, frequently uses slow fermentation techniques, such as sourdough. This process involves a long fermentation period (often 24+ hours), during which natural yeasts and bacteria work to break down gluten and other difficult-to-digest components like fructans (a type of FODMAP) and phytic acid. This has several health benefits:

  • Improved Digestion: The pre-digestion of gluten and starches makes the final product much easier for the body to process.
  • Enhanced Nutrient Absorption: The breakdown of phytic acid, an anti-nutrient, allows for better mineral absorption from the bread.
  • Lower Glycemic Index: The slow fermentation process results in a lower glycemic index for the bread, which helps regulate blood sugar levels.

In contrast, modern commercial baking in the U.S. prioritizes speed and efficiency, often relying on rapid-rise commercial yeast and numerous additives to expedite the process. This skips the crucial fermentation stage that aids in digestibility.

Q: Does European flour contain less gluten? A: Yes, European flour is typically milled from soft wheat varieties that naturally have a lower gluten content compared to the hard red wheat commonly used for mass-market flour in the U.S..

Q: Can people with celiac disease eat European flour? A: No. While European flour may be easier to digest for those with non-celiac gluten sensitivity, it still contains gluten and should be avoided by individuals with celiac disease.

Q: What is the deal with glyphosate and European flour? A: Unlike in the U.S., the EU has banned or heavily restricted the use of glyphosate on wheat crops, leading to significantly lower or non-existent chemical residues in the final flour.

Q: Is the slow fermentation process really that important? A: Yes. Slow fermentation, like that used in sourdough baking, helps break down gluten, fructans, and phytic acid, which can drastically improve the digestibility of the bread and enhance mineral absorption.

Q: Are American food additives the only reason for digestion problems? A: No. The higher gluten content in American wheat, the faster commercial baking process, and the fortification with specific types of iron all contribute to why some people experience digestive discomfort.

Q: Is all European bread made with traditional methods? A: No. While traditional methods are more common, especially in artisanal bakeries, commercially produced bread in Europe can still use faster, less traditional processes. Always check the ingredients and preparation.

Q: Can I find high-quality alternatives to European flour in the U.S.? A: Yes. Look for organic American flours that prioritize traditional processing, or seek out heritage grain varieties which are often processed with similar methods to European flours.
